mysql中limit的用法詳解(資料分頁常用)

標籤:在我們使用查詢語句的時候,經常要返回前幾條或者中間某幾行資料,這個時候怎麼辦呢?不用擔心,Mysql已經為我們提供了這樣一個功能。SELECT * FROM table  LIMIT [offset,] rows | rows OFFSET offsetLIMIT 子句可以被用於強制 SELECT

mysql入門基礎及mysql安裝(01)

標籤:oracle   資料庫管理   sql語言   電腦   伺服器      資料庫是儲存和管理資料的倉庫,但是資料庫本身不能直接儲存資料,資料存放區在表中。儲存資料必然會用到資料庫伺服器,即就是一台電腦上安裝了資料庫管理程式,如:mysql。 

MySQL-5.6.29源碼編譯安裝記錄

標籤:mysql   mysql編譯   一、安裝環境1. 作業系統:CentOS 6.7 x86_64# yum install make cmake gcc gcc-c++ gcc-g77 flex bison file libtool libtool-libs autoconf kernel-devel patch wget libjpeg libjpeg-devel libpng libpng-devel libpng10

Mysql 將結果儲存到檔案 從檔案裡運行sql語句 記錄操作過程(tee 命令的使用)

標籤:1.  有時候我們可能須要記錄我們對mysql的操作過程,這時我們能夠使用mysql的tee命令            

MySQL - 查看慢SQL

標籤:【轉載地址:http://www.cnblogs.com/xzpp/archive/2012/07/18/2598136.html】查看MySQL是否啟用了查看慢SQL的記錄檔(1) 查看慢SQL日誌是否啟用mysql> show variables like ‘log_slow_queries‘; +------------------+-------+| Variable_name    | Value |+----------------

在CentOS6.7上編譯安裝MySQL 5.7.11

標籤:mysql系統內容:CentOS 6.7MYSQL版本:5.7.11 安裝依賴包yum -y install gcc gcc-c++ ncurses ncurses-devel cmake 查看系統是否內建mysql和boost,如有則先卸載rpm -qa mysql boostyum remove -y mysql rm /etc/my.cnf -f     #刪除系統原有的mysql設定檔,如果有的話yum remove

Mysql使用最佳化之處

標籤:1 開啟事務之前需要rollback 串連控制代碼。(清理垃圾)2 mysql_ping 失敗,程式需要處理重連邏輯;3 mysql_query()執行的SQL語句是一個以‘/0’結尾的字串,而mysql_real_query()執行的字串長度是參數指定的,因此,前者不能不能包含位元據(位元據中可能會包含‘/0’,導致被認為到達字串末尾)實際使用中,推薦使用mysql_real_query4 mysql C API  

mysql 遊標的使用方法

標籤:BEGIN/*計算使用者提成總金額*/declare amountPrice,pays,rates,goodsPrice DECIMAL(10,2) DEFAULT 0;DECLARE flag int,getUserId;#if(userlevel=1) thenSELECT member_id into getUserId from 33hao_member where openid=open_iddeclare cur cursor for select

mysql分庫分表總結

標籤:單庫單表 單庫單表是最常見的資料庫設計,例如,有一張使用者(user)表放在資料庫db中,所有的使用者都可以在db庫中的user表中查到。 單庫多表 隨著使用者數量的增加,user表的資料量會越來越大,當資料量達到一定程度的時候對user表的查詢會漸漸的變慢,從而影響整個DB的效能。如果使用mysql,

0、mac下安裝mysql

標籤:mac   mysql   1、下載mysql:http://www.mysql.com/downloads/選擇: MySQL Community Edition (GPL)下載mac版,然後解壓安裝。2、安裝:解壓下載下來的檔案,雙擊以標按引導來安裝:650) this.width=650;"

[轉]MySQL 資料備份與還原

標籤:轉自:http://www.cnblogs.com/kissdodog/p/4174421.html 一、資料備份  1、使用mysqldump命令備份  mysqldump命令將資料庫中的資料備份成一個文字檔。表的結構和表中的資料將儲存在產生的文字檔中。  mysqldump命令的工作原理很簡單。它先查出需要備份的表的結構,再在文字檔中產生一個CREATE語句。然後,將表中的所有記錄轉換成一條INSERT語句。然後通過這些語句,就能夠建立表並插入資料。  1、備份一個資料庫  

MySQL的log_bin和sql_log_bin 到底有什麼區別?

標籤:mysql的log_bin和sql_log_bin 到底有什麼區別?利用二進位還原資料庫的時候,突然有點糾結,log_bin和sql_log_bin有什麼區別呢?行吧,搜搜,結合自己的經驗,簡單說一下。log_bin:二進位日誌。在 mysql 啟動時,通過命令列或設定檔決定是否開啟 binlog,而 log_bin 這個變數僅僅是報告當前 binlog 系統的狀態(開啟與否)。若你想要關閉 binlog,你可以通過修改 sql_log_bin 並把原來的串連 kill 掉,也可以修改

mysql設定遠程登入

標籤:伺服器上,我們剛安裝好MySQL後,是沒有辦法直接遠端,它只支援本地登入。所以我們必須要對剛安裝好的MySQL進行設定,允許遠程登入。 1. 使用“mysql -uroot -p”命令可以串連到本地的mysql服務。2.使用“use mysql”命令,選擇要使用的資料庫,修改遠端連線的基本資料,儲存在mysql資料庫中,因此使用mysql資料庫。3. 使用“GRANT ALL PRIVILEGES ON *.* TO ‘

怎麼樣使用yum來安裝mysql

標籤:linux下使用yum安裝mysql,以及啟動、登入和遠端存取。1、安裝查看有沒有安裝過:          yum list installed mysql*          rpm -qa | grep mysql*查

MySQL資料庫鎖機制之MyISAM引擎表鎖和InnoDB行鎖詳解

標籤:MySQL中的鎖概念Mysql中不同的儲存引擎支援不同的鎖機制。比如MyISAM和MEMORY儲存引擎採用的表級鎖,BDB採用的是頁面鎖,也支援表級鎖,InnoDB儲存引擎既支援行級鎖,也支援表級鎖,預設情況下採用行級鎖。Mysql3中鎖特性如下:表級鎖:開銷小,加鎖塊;不會出現死結,鎖定粒度大,發生鎖衝突的機率最高,並發度最低。行級鎖:開銷大,加鎖慢;會出現死結;鎖定粒度最小,發生鎖衝突的機率最低,並發性也最高。頁面鎖:開銷和加鎖界於表鎖和行鎖之間,會出現死結;鎖定粒度界與表鎖和行鎖之間

Mysql外鍵約束

標籤:        Mysql叢集建立外鍵,分為四種約束:no action,restrict,cascade,set null。如果表A的主關鍵字是表B中的欄位,則該欄位稱為B的外鍵,表A稱為主表,表B稱為從表。外鍵是用來實現參照完整性的,不同的外鍵不同的外鍵約束方式將可以使兩張表緊密的結合起來,特別是修改或者刪除的級聯操作將使得日常的維護工作更加輕鬆。  CASCADE:

MySQL 入門(三)—— MySQL資料類型

標籤:MySQL的資料類型包括整數類型、浮點數類型、定點數類型、日期和時間類型、字串類型和位元據類型。不同資料類型決定了資料的儲存格式、有效範圍和相應的限制。1、整數類型MySQL支援的整數類型如下表所示 MySQL支援資料類型的名稱後面指定該類型的顯示寬度,基本形式如下: 資料類型(顯示寬度)顯示寬度指能夠顯示的最大資料的長度。在不指定寬度的情況下,整數類型的預設顯示寬度與其有符號數的最大值的顯示寬度相同。如INT型為11,BIGINT型為20。

MySQL資料庫insert和update語句

標籤:MySQL資料庫insert和update語句引:用於操作資料庫的SQL一般分為兩種,一種是查詢語句,也就是我們所說的SELECT語句,另外一種就是更新語句,也叫做資料動作陳述式。言外之意,就是對資料進行修改。在標準的SQL中有3個語句,它們是INSERT、UPDATE以及DELETE。用於操作資料庫的SQL一般分為兩種,一種是查詢語句,也就是我們所說的SELECT語句,另外一種就是更新語句,也叫做資料動作陳述式。言外之意,就

在centos-6.3中安裝mysql-5.5.48

標籤:採用源碼編譯方式在centos-6.3中安裝mysql-5.5.48,編譯器使用cmake。軟體包:mysql-5.5.48.tar.gz和cmake-2.8.10.2.tar.gz軟體包:http://mysql.mirror.kangaroot.net/Downloads/ 或 http://pan.baidu.com/s/1pLKOC0zhttp://www.cmake.org/files 或 http://pan.baidu.com/s/1slSmhAX步驟:1

mysql預存程序基礎

標籤:DELIMITER //create procedure ss(in x1 int)begininsert into pro(id) values(x1);end//DELIMITER ;call ss(1004);################################查看: 方法一:(直接查詢,比較實用,查看當前自訂的預存程序)select `specific_name` from mysql.proc where `db` = ‘your_db_

總頁數: 2483 1 .... 1836 1837 1838 1839 1840 .... 2483 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.